About

Yiming Ma is a scholar working on Geophysics, Molecular Biology and Electrical and Electronic Engineering. According to data from OpenAlex, Yiming Ma has authored 55 papers receiving a total of 1.1k indexed citations (citations by other indexed papers that have themselves been cited), including 32 papers in Geophysics, 22 papers in Molecular Biology and 13 papers in Electrical and Electronic Engineering. Recurrent topics in Yiming Ma's work include Geological and Geochemical Analysis (32 papers), Geomagnetism and Paleomagnetism Studies (22 papers) and High-pressure geophysics and materials (16 papers). Yiming Ma is often cited by papers focused on Geological and Geochemical Analysis (32 papers), Geomagnetism and Paleomagnetism Studies (22 papers) and High-pressure geophysics and materials (16 papers). Yiming Ma collaborates with scholars based in China, Singapore and United States. Yiming Ma's co-authors include Tianshui Yang, Huaichun Wu, Shihong Zhang, Haiyan Li, Weiwei Bian, Zhenyu Yang, Jingjie Jin, Jikai Ding, Qiang Wang and Liwan Cao and has published in prestigious journals such as Scientific Reports, Earth and Planetary Science Letters and Geophysical Research Letters.
